These AMHR ELISA kits are immunodetection tools for measuring the levels of AMHR in biological samples. AMHR is an alias of the human AMHR2 gene, which encodes the protein, anti-Mullerian hormone receptor type 2. Notably, AMHR is known to play a role in blood vessel development and male gonad development, among other functions. The AMHR2 protein is 573 amino acid residues in length and 62.8 kilodaltons in mass. However, as many as 3 protein isoforms have been identified. It is localized to the membrane of the cell. This protein is known to be glycosylated. Other names for this target antigen include MISR2.
